## 3.1.0 — Import defaults

FieldForge's CSV import wizard now defaults to UTF-8 with BOM detection, strict header matching off, and a 50k-row preview cap (was 5k). Delimiter sniffing runs on the first 20 lines. No migration needed; existing saved mappings unaffected. Effective defaults for the import service follow.

settings of bawif-fawif:
ralix:
  log_level: warn
  metrics_host: metrics.ralix.tolvaqsys.internal
  pool_size: 32

## Formula sandbox tuning

User-supplied formulas in Gridmoor execute inside a restricted interpreter with hard ceilings on time, memory, and call depth. Reviewers should confirm any change to these ceilings is justified in the PR description, since raising them widens the abuse surface. Defaults were chosen from production traces. The current limits are as follows.

limits module of tafog-fawip:
WEIGHTS = {
    "julix": 57,
    "lamys": 992,
    "kasvan": 209,
    "quenok": 750,
    "alddor": 259,
    "oliath": 1009,
    "wenix": 815,
}

## Fan-out Backpressure

Pushfield fans notifications out to device channels via Quillfeather workers. When downstream queues exceed the high-water mark, producers throttle automatically; do not disable this manually. Symptoms of saturation: rising publish latency, shed low-priority batches. First response: check worker pool health, then queue depth. Full backpressure tuning guidance is on the internal engineering page.

wiki page, hahog-yahog: https://jira.plorvaworks.corp/display/dash/pages/pages/repo/display/spaces/7b9c5df2c5490ad9694860b5

Visitors to the Stillwater Room on the ninth floor of Harlock House must be signed in at reception and accompanied at all times by a member of staff. The room is reserved for quiet reflection and confidential conversations, so please remind guests to silence their devices before the lift doors open on nine. No food, photography, or recording equipment is permitted inside. If the escorting employee has not arrived within ten minutes, ask the guest to wait in the lobby lounge. Escorts should unlock the corridor door using the following pass code.

badge for fafop-fajof: bdg-Z-47